Desktop Computer or Mini PC: Finding the Right Fit

Deciding between a traditional machine and a compact PC can be tricky, depending on your usage. A standard computer generally offers more performance and room for upgrades, making it ideal for demanding tasks like gaming. However, mini PCs are increasingly efficient and deliver a noticeable advantage in terms of footprint, portability, and sometimes energy efficiency. Consider your budget and intended use cases to ascertain the optimal answer for you.

Upgrade Your Workspace: Monitors, Laptops & Desktops Compared

Choosing the right equipment for your workspace can be a task. Should you select a capable desktop PC, a portable laptop, or an expansive monitor setup? Tower computers offer superior capabilities and are generally more affordable for the features, but lack the portability of a laptop. Notebooks are fantastic for remote work, but often sacrifice screen area and internal power. Finally, an additional monitor can significantly increase your workflow, regardless of whether you employ a desktop or a portable. Consider your requirements to make the best decision.
